San Francisco homeboy DJG (Lo Dubs, NarcoHZ, Wheel & Deal) comes to this Dubstep thing with a vibe all his own and deep sexy basslines to rattle your soul! In the dance, Dean proves his mettle and versatility rocking fresh dubs from top ranking producers worldwide. DJG played a smashing set at Various in April 2009 and we loved it so much, we insisted he return for our 3 year party!
He has a slew of releases on labels such as Narco HZ, Tube 10, Untitled!, Pressing Issues and Noppa as well as a 12" coming out on Lo Dubs very soon ("The Gate" / "Obsessed").

Extra special guest ... LLOOP!
LLOOP - pioneer of illbeint downtempo, jungle and dub, Lloop, alongside Once 11 and Dj Olive was a member of the seminal New York City trio known as We™. Born Rich Panciera in Philidelphia, Rich spent the mid/late 1990's in NYC working prolifically with We as well as solo and doing remix work for the likes of David Byrne and Silver Apples. He is currently living in Wein, Austria.
In 2008, he released a superb chunk of Dubwise dubstep called "60 Hertz" on theAgriculture. We are especially pleased to be graced with a rare appearance of one of our favorites!!!
